The Railway Recruitment Board (RRB) will release the answer key for the Junior Engineer (JE) recruitment exam under CEN 03/2024 shortly after the completion of the Computer-Based Test (CBT). The answer key helps candidates verify their responses and estimate their scores. It also provides an opportunity to raise objections if discrepancies are found. RRB JE 2024 Answer Key
The 1st Stage Computer Based Test (CBT-I) for the post of JE, DMS, CMA etc. against CEN No. 03/2024 was conducted from 16.12.2024 to 18.12.2024. In order to enable candidates who appeared in the CBT-I to view their question papers, responses and answer keys, a link has been provided on the websites of RRBs which will be active from 23.12.2024 @ 18:00 hrs. to 28.12.2024 @23:55 hrs.

The prescribed fee for raising objection is Rs.50/- plus applicable Bank Service Charges per question. In case the objection raised is found to be correct, the fee paid against such valid objections shall be refunded to the candidate after deduction of applicable Bank charges. The refund will be made to the account from where the candidate has made the online payment.
Key Dates for RRB JE 2024 Answer Key
| Event | Date (Tentative) |
|---|---|
| CBT Exam Date | 16 Dec 2024 – 18 Dec 2024 |
| Release of Provisional Answer Key | 23 Dec 2024 |
| Objection Window | 23 Dec 2024 – 28 Dec 2024 |
| Final Answer Key Release | To be announced |
How to Download the RRB JE 2024 Answer Key
Follow these steps to download the answer key:
- Visit the official RRB website of your respective region (e.g., RRB Mumbai, RRB Chennai).
- Click on the link titled “RRB JE 2024 Answer Key” on the homepage.
- Log in using your Registration Number and Date of Birth (DOB).
- The answer key for your CBT will be displayed on the screen.
- Download and save the PDF for future reference.

Steps to Raise Objections
If you find discrepancies in the provisional answer key, you can raise objections within the specified objection window. Here’s how:
- Log in to the official RRB portal with your credentials.
- Click on the “Raise Objections” link.
- Select the question(s) you wish to challenge and provide valid supporting evidence.
- Pay the requisite fee (if applicable) for each objection.
- Submit the objection before the deadline.
